Common Ceiling Removal Service Jobs
Ceiling removal for remodeling - facilitates updates to room layouts and interior designs.
Suspended ceiling removal - allows for access to hidden wiring, ductwork, or insulation.
Popcorn ceiling removal - enhances interior aesthetics and improves ceiling surface quality.
Asbestos ceiling removal - ensures safe removal of hazardous materials in older properties.
Drop ceiling removal - creates open space or prepares for new ceiling installations.
Ceiling tile removal - simplifies renovation projects and updates interior decor.
Ceiling Removal Service Questions
What types of ceilings can be removed? Ceiling removal services typically handle drywall, plaster, popcorn, and suspended ceilings to accommodate renovation or repair projects.
Is ceiling removal suitable for renovation projects? Yes, ceiling removal is often part of remodeling to update or redesign interior spaces.
What should property owners consider before removal? It's important to assess structural elements, electrical wiring, and insulation that may be affected during ceiling removal.
Can ceiling removal improve room aesthetics? Removing old or damaged ceilings can create a cleaner, more modern look for interior spaces.
